Finding the right physician who is the right fit can require many "interviews." Don't be afraid to "just say no" if the doctor you see isn't a good fit. Above all, don't give up. The right doctor is out there. Like the fairy-tale princess, you may have to kiss a lot of frogs before you find your prince/princess.
Personal referrals are often the best way to find a good doctor. If you belong to a support group, ask people in it. Ask if you can use their name when you call for an appointment.
